Fuel Injector Fouling and Failure

Fuel injectors are precision components that deliver diesel into the combustion chamber at exactly the right moment, in exactly the right quantity. When they are working correctly, the engine runs smoothly, efficiently and with good power delivery. When they begin to fail — through fouling, wear, or carbon build-up — the symptoms are hard to miss.


Common signs of injector problems include:


  • Rough idle or uneven running, particularly when cold
  • Black or excessive smoke from the exhaust
  • Noticeable loss of power or fuel economy
  • Hard starting, especially in cold conditions
  • Engine misfires under load


In heavy vehicles operating in this region, injector issues are often accelerated by fuel quality variation, extended service intervals and the high-load conditions common in earthmoving and agricultural work. Regular diagnostics and timely replacement are more cost-effective than allowing injector problems to progress to the point where they affect other components.

Overheating and Cooling System Failures

Heavy vehicle cooling systems carry an enormous workload. The amount of heat generated by a large diesel engine under sustained load — particularly during summer in north-east Victoria — demands a cooling system that is functioning at full capacity. When any component begins to degrade, the consequences can be severe.


Common cooling system issues in heavy vehicles include:


  • Coolant leaks from hoses, the radiator or the head gasket
  • Thermostat failure causing the engine to run too hot or too cold
  • Water pump wear leading to inadequate coolant circulation
  • Radiator blockage reducing heat transfer capacity
  • Air pockets in the cooling circuit causing localised overheating


Overheating is one of the most damaging things that can happen to a diesel engine. A single significant overheating event can warp cylinder heads, damage head gaskets or cause scoring in the cylinders — repairs that run to thousands of dollars. Keeping the cooling system inspected, serviced and running correctly is non-negotiable for any serious heavy vehicle operator.

Turbocharger Issues

Most modern heavy diesel engines rely on a turbocharger to force additional air into the combustion chamber, allowing more fuel to be burned and generating the power output that heavy work demands. Turbos are robust components, but they operate at extreme temperatures and RPMs, and they require consistent lubrication and clean intake air to function correctly.


Turbocharger problems typically develop gradually and include:


  • Blue or white smoke from the exhaust, indicating oil is entering the intake or exhaust
  • Whining, rattling or grinding noises from the turbo itself
  • Loss of power and reduced throttle response
  • Excessive oil consumption
  • Boost pressure that is lower than expected


The most common cause of turbocharger failure in heavy vehicles is oil starvation — either from infrequent oil changes allowing the oil to degrade, or from oil passages becoming restricted. Running a diesel engine with degraded oil is particularly damaging to turbo bearings. For heavy vehicles doing intensive work across construction and agricultural sites, maintaining oil change intervals is a direct investment in turbocharger longevity.

EGR Valve Problems

The Exhaust Gas Recirculation (EGR) system reduces nitrogen oxide emissions by recirculating a portion of exhaust gas back into the intake manifold. It is effective from an emissions perspective, but it is also one of the more maintenance-intensive systems in a modern diesel engine because exhaust gas is dirty, hot and carries soot and carbon deposits that progressively coat and clog the EGR valve and related passages.


Symptoms of EGR valve issues include:


  • Rough idle and erratic engine behaviour
  • Increased fuel consumption
  • Black smoke from the exhaust
  • Engine warning lights on the dash
  • Reduced power, particularly under load


For heavy vehicles operating in dusty agricultural or construction environments, EGR systems tend to foul faster than in cleaner operating conditions. Regular inspection and cleaning — or replacement when the valve is no longer functioning correctly — keeps the engine running efficiently and prevents the kind of progressive performance decline that operators sometimes accept as normal but which represents real money in wasted fuel.

Glow Plug Failure

Glow plugs are the starting point for a diesel engine's cold-start cycle. Unlike petrol engines, diesel engines ignite fuel through compression heat rather than a spark, and glow plugs provide an initial heat source in the pre-chamber or combustion chamber to assist with cold starts when the engine and ambient temperature are low. Wodonga's winters are genuinely cold, and the cold-start demands on a heavy diesel — particularly one that has been sitting overnight — are significant.


Glow plug failure makes itself known through:


  • Extended cranking before the engine fires
  • Rough running during the warm-up period
  • White smoke from the exhaust when starting
  • Hard starting or failure to start in cold conditions
  • Engine management warning lights


Glow plugs are relatively inexpensive to replace but are sometimes ignored until they cause a no-start situation on a cold morning. Proactive replacement as part of a scheduled maintenance program avoids that scenario and the downtime that comes with it.

Fuel System Contamination

Diesel fuel contamination — most commonly water ingress, but also microbial growth in fuel tanks and particulate contamination from degraded tank linings — is a problem that affects heavy vehicles differently from passenger cars. Larger fuel tanks, vehicles that may sit unused for extended periods, and the practical realities of refuelling in remote or agricultural settings all create conditions where contamination is more likely.


Water in diesel fuel is particularly damaging. It does not combust, it causes injector and pump corrosion, and it promotes the growth of microbial colonies that further degrade fuel quality and block filters. Vehicles that develop a pattern of frequent fuel filter replacements, sluggish performance or injector issues should have their fuel quality and tank integrity checked as part of the diagnostic process.


  • Regular fuel filter changes remain the first line of defence
  • Fuel tank inspections and draining catch water contamination early
  • Fuel polishing services remove contamination from existing fuel

Hydraulic System Wear and Hose Failures

For earthmoving and construction equipment, the hydraulic system is as critical as the engine itself. Excavators, loaders, dozers and agricultural equipment all rely on hydraulic circuits to operate attachments, steering and braking systems. Hydraulic hose failures are among the most common maintenance issues for this class of equipment.


Hoses degrade through age, UV exposure, abrasion against machine components, and the pressure cycling inherent in normal hydraulic system operation. A burst hose is not just a maintenance problem — it is an immediate operational shutdown, a potential safety incident and an environmental concern if hydraulic fluid is released.


  • Proactive hose inspection at regular intervals identifies wear before failure
  • On-site hose replacement services minimise downtime when failures do occur
  • Hydraulic fluid quality and contamination should be checked as part of regular servicing

The Value of Preventative Maintenance

Heavy vehicle repairs are expensive — both in parts and labour, and in the downtime that comes when a vehicle is out of service. The pattern across most of the problems described above is the same: they start small, develop progressively, and become significantly more costly the longer they are left. An injector that needs cleaning becomes an injector that needs replacement. A cooling system with a minor leak becomes a warped cylinder head. The mechanics who understand this work are the ones who deliver the most value to their clients — not by finding more work to do, but by finding the right work to do at the right time. A well-maintained heavy vehicle costs less to run, lasts longer and generates more revenue than one managed reactively.
